When I try to search my local folders, including subfolders, which contain a lot
(407 megabytes) of data, the search stops somewhere in the middle while the
status line of the search dialog displays a message saying "Building summary
file for [subfolder name]". When this happens, if I look in the folder, there is
nothing visible in it. If I close email and restart, the folder still appears
empty. If I close Mozilla entirely, including the quickstart, everything resets
and the folder is displayed properly, but repeating the same search produces a
hangup at the same place. If I delete the folder, and search again, the problem
occurs on another folder. The problem occurs regardless of whether the search is
of the subject line or the body, but does not occur for smaller searches that
encompass just the subfolder on which the search will hang if a more
comprehensive search is done. 

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Do a search of subject line or body on Local Folders including subfolders.
2. Wait for the search to hang up with a message saying ""Building summary file
for [subfolder name]"
Actual Results:  
The search stops somewhere in the middle while the status line of the search
dialog displays a message saying "Building summary file for [subfolder name]".

Expected Results:  
Completed the search.
